About the Role: We are excited to invite an experienced Roving Community Manager to join our growing team, you will support communities in Orange County, CA. In this role, you will oversee all aspects of property management roving between multiple properties, including resident relations, site mangement and compliance. You’ll be responsible for maintaining a positive community atmosphere, ensuring the financial health of the property, and managing the daily operations with a special focus lease-up and compliance. What You’ll Do:

  • Oversee the day-to-day operations of the property, ensuring it runs smoothly and efficiently while maintaining a high standard of service for residents.
  • Lead and supervise the leasing team, including managing resident applications, screenings, move-ins, and move-outs.
  • Ensure the property is fully compliant with Project-Based Section 8 regulations, including conducting annual recertifications, updating tenant files, and managing waitlists.
  • Monitor and enforce compliance with all affordable housing regulations, ensuring that policies are followed consistently and accurately.
  • Develop and manage the property’s budget, ensuring financial goals are met, expenses are controlled, and rent collections are on target.
  • Build strong relationships with residents, address resident concerns, and maintain a positive community atmosphere.
  • Work closely with maintenance staff to ensure the property is well-maintained and any service requests are handled promptly.
  • Coordinate with vendors, contractors, and other third-party service providers to complete capital improvements and maintenance projects.
  • Prepare and submit all required reports and documentation to regulatory agencies and ownership.

What We’re Looking For:

  • 3 years of property management experience.
  • In-depth knowledge of coventional and affordable housing compliance.
  • Applicants must possess a high school diploma or equivalent.
  • Strong financial management skills, including budget preparation, rent collections, and cost control.
  • Proven experience in supervising and leading a team, with exc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Expertise in using property management software (Yardi or similar) and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Strong problem-solving and conflict resolution skills with a focus on maintaining positive resident relations.
  • A self-starter with the ability to manage multiple tasks and priorities in a fast-paced environment.
